Moscow has ended a self-declared Christmas ceasefire and vowed to push on with combat until it reaches a victory over its neighbour. Russia says it will press ahead with what it calls a “special military operation” in Ukraine after ending its 36-hour ceasefire as fighting between the two European neighbours enters its 318th day.
